#NeuralPlasticity & #learning are distinct but interrelated processes. #Plasticity denotes biological change in #NeuralSystems, while learning is its functional expression in #NetworkDynamics & #behavior. Learning arises from coordinated plastic processes, reshaping #NeuralStateSpace & #attractors to support stable yet flexible representations.
